Создание сервера без хостинга

Если у тебя есть идея для проекта, но ты не хочешь платить за хостинг, или просто любишь экспериментировать, то мы покажем тебе, как создать сервер без использования услуг хостинга.

Для этого тебе понадобится компьютер с постоянным доступом в Интернет. Можно использовать свой компьютер или купить отдельный сервер, но главное - надежное соединение с Интернетом, так как сервер должен быть доступен 24/7.

Зарегистрируйте домен

Выберите надежного регистратора доменов и следуйте их инструкциям для завершения процесса регистрации. После успешной регистрации домена, настройте его DNS-записи для указания на IP-адрес вашего сервера.

Выберите регистратора доменов
4Зарегистрируйте домен
5Настройте DNS записи домена

При выборе доменного имени важно учесть его уникальность и легкость запоминания. Желательно, чтобы доменное имя отражало суть вашего проекта или бизнеса.

Для проверки доступности выбранного домена можно воспользоваться онлайн-сервисами различных регистраторов доменов. Они покажут, зарегистрировано ли уже указанное вами доменное имя.

Выбор регистратора доменов важен, так как это компания, через которую вы будете регистрировать ваш домен. Обратите внимание на цену регистрации, качество услуг и процесс переноса домена, если в будущем захотите сменить регистратора.

После выбора регистратора начните регистрацию домена. Заполните данные, выберите срок и оплатите.

После удачной регистрации настройте DNS записи домена. Регистратор обычно предоставляет удобный интерфейс для этого.

После завершения всех шагов домен будет готов к использованию. Укажите его в настройках сервера для доступа к проекту.

Выбор доменного имени

Выбор доменного имени

При выборе учтите, что имя должно быть легко запоминающимся и понятным пользователям.

Доменное имя должно быть коротким и простым, чтобы его легко было запомнить и ввести в адресную строку браузера. Избегайте сложных и длинных слов.

Также важно, чтобы доменное имя было уникальным и не использовалось другими компаниями или серверами. Уникальность помогает вашему серверу выделиться и привлечь больше пользователей.

Перед выбором доменного имени стоит проверить рынок и узнать, какие имена уже заняты. Это поможет избежать путаницы и убедиться, что ваше доменное имя отличается от других.

Важно учесть доменную зону, которую вы выберете. Например, .com - самая популярная зона, .org - для некоммерческих организаций, .net - для сетевых компаний.

Выбор регистратора

Выбор регистратора

При выборе регистратора учтите несколько ключевых факторов:

1. Цена и условия регистрации

Цена и условия регистрации могут сильно отличаться. Не выбирайте компанию только из-за низкой цены. Обратите внимание на срок регистрации, возможность продления и платежные условия.

2. Поддержка клиентов

Регистрация и управление доменами могут вызвать вопросы, особенно у новичков. Поэтому важно проверить уровень поддержки клиентов, предоставляемый регистратором. Изучите отзывы клиентов и обратите внимание на доступность и качество поддержки.

3. Надежность и безопасность

Выбирайте регистратора с хорошей репутацией и долгой историей работы. Убедитесь, что регистратор предлагает надежную защиту доменов от взломов и мошенничества. Также важно узнать, какие меры безопасности принимаются при переносе домена и смене регистратора.

4. Дополнительные функции и инструменты

Некоторые регистраторы предлагают дополнительные функции и инструменты, которые могут пригодиться в управлении доменом. Например, DNS-серверы, защита от спама, SSL-сертификаты и другие функции. Подумайте, какие именно функции вам нужны, и проверьте их наличие у выбранного регистратора.

Учитывайте эти факторы при выборе регистратора, чтобы убедиться, что ваше доменное имя будет зарегистрировано и управляться надежной компанией.

Настройка сервера

Настройка сервера

Для создания сервера без использования хостинга, выполните следующие шаги:

1. Выберите серверное ПО:

Перед настройкой сервера выберите подходящее серверное ПО: Apache, Nginx или Microsoft IIS. Каждый имеет свои преимущества, выбор зависит от ваших потребностей.

2. Установка серверного ПО:

После выбора установите его на компьютер или виртуальную машину. Загрузите пакет с официального сайта и следуйте инструкциям.

3. Конфигурация сервера:

После установки серверного ПО нужно его настроить. Настройка включает выбор порта, корневой папки, прав доступа и других параметров.

4. Создание и настройка сайта:

После этого можно создать и настроить сайт на сервере. Загрузите файлы на сервер, настройте файл конфигурации (например, .htaccess для Apache) и проверьте сайт в браузере.

Не забывайте делать резервные копии данных на сервере для безопасности.

Следуя этим шагам, вы сможете настроить свой собственный сервер без использования хостинга для размещения веб-сайтов и других приложений.

Выбор сервера

Выбор сервера

При выборе сервера для создания сервера без хостинга нужно учесть несколько основных факторов:

1. Программное обеспечение:

Перед выбором сервера, убедитесь, что он поддерживает технологии, которые вы собираетесь использовать на вашем сервере. Например, если вы планируете использовать PHP для создания динамического контента, убедитесь, что сервер поддерживает PHP.

2. Производительность:

Определите, какой объем трафика и нагрузки вы ожидаете на вашем сервере. Выберите сервер с достаточными ресурсами, чтобы обрабатывать эту нагрузку без задержек в работе или снижения производительности.

3. Надежность:

Найдите сервер, который гарантирует доступность и надежность ваших данных. Важно выбрать надежного провайдера, чтобы сервер всегда был доступен для ваших пользователей.

4. Цена:

Сравните цены различных серверов и убедитесь, что выбранный сервер подходит по цене. Некоторые провайдеры предлагают бесплатные планы, но они могут быть ограничены по возможностям и надежности.

Выбор сервера - ключевой фактор для создания сервера без хостинга. Тщательно изучите рынок и выберите сервер, который наилучшим образом соответствует вашим потребностям и бюджету.

Установка операционной системы

Установка операционной системы

Прежде чем создать сервер без хостинга, необходимо установить операционную систему на вашем компьютере. Это позволит вам создавать и оптимизировать веб-сайты непосредственно на своем собственном устройстве.

Выберите операционную систему для вашего сервера - Windows, Linux или MacOS. Linux - наиболее популярный выбор из-за широких возможностей.

Скачайте и установите необходимые файлы в соответствии с выбранной ОС.

Для установки Linux нужно скачать образ диска (.iso файл), записать на флеш-накопитель или DVD, загрузить компьютер с носителя и следовать инструкциям по установке ОС.

После установки настроить параметры, такие как сетевые настройки и безопасность, чтобы сервер функционировал правильно и был защищен от угроз.

Также установить необходимые программы и пакеты, например, сервер баз данных или сервер PHP, если планируете создавать динамические веб-страницы.

  • Apache: работает на Windows, macOS и Linux
  • Nginx: поддерживается на macOS и Linux
  • IIS: предустановлен на Windows
  • Apache HTTP Server: Этот сервер широко используется по всему миру и обладает обширной документацией.
  • Nginx: Этот сервер известен своей высокой производительностью и используется для обслуживания статического контента.
  • Microsoft Internet Information Services (IIS): Этот сервер входит в состав операционной системы Windows и хорош для разработки .NET-приложений.
  • Для установки выбранного веб-сервера следуйте инструкциям на официальном сайте. Обычно это включает скачивание установочного файла и запуск установщика.

    После установки веб-сервера, настройте его для работы с вашим веб-приложением или сайтом. Потребуется настроить порты, виртуальные хосты и другие параметры.

    Когда веб-сервер готов, размещайте ваши веб-страницы на локальном сервере и открывайте их в браузере. Так можно тестировать и разрабатывать веб-приложения без хостинг-провайдера.

    Настройка DNS

    Настройка DNS

    Для настройки DNS для вашего сервера:

    1. Зарегистрируйте доменное имя

    Сначала зарегистрируйте уникальное доменное имя для вашего сервера. Множество компаний предлагают услуги регистрации доменных имен, такие как NAMECHEAP, GoDaddy и другие. Выберите провайдера, проверьте доступность домена и зарегистрируйте его.

    2. Войдите в панель управления доменом

    После успешной регистрации домена, получите доступ к панели управления, предоставляемой провайдером. Войдите, используя учетные данные.

    3. Найдите настройки DNS

    Ищите раздел "DNS" или "DNS-сервер" в вашем аккаунте у провайдера. Здесь вы сможете изменить DNS-записи.

    4. Добавьте DNS-записи

    В зависимости от вашего сервера и потребностей, вам нужно будет добавить различные DNS-записи. Обычно требуется добавить A-запись, указывающую на IP-адрес вашего сервера, и, возможно, CNAME-записи для поддоменов.

    5. Сохранить изменения

    После добавления DNS-записей не забудьте сохранить изменения. Убедитесь, что все записи настроены правильно и не содержат опечаток.

    Примечание: Изменения в DNS-записях могут занять некоторое время, чтобы распространиться по всему Интернету. Поэтому необходимо подождать некоторое время, прежде чем проверять работу настроек.

    Теперь, после настройки DNS, ваш сервер будет доступен по доменному имени.

    Создание зон и записей

    Создание зон и записей

    При создании сервера без хостинга важно учесть создание специальных зон и записей DNS (Domain Name System). Эти зоны и записи позволяют соотносить IP-адреса сервера с его доменными именами.

    Для создания зон и записей DNS выполните следующие шаги:

    1. Выберите подходящее доменное имя для сервера, например, "myserver.com".
    2. Зарегистрируйте выбранное доменное имя у аккредитованного регистратора доменов.
    3. Создайте зону DNS для доменного имени на вашем сервере с помощью специальных утилит или консольных команд.
    4. Добавьте A-запись (Address Record) для указания IP-адреса сервера. A-запись создается внутри зоны DNS и указывает на IP-адрес сервера, связанный с доменным именем.
    5. Добавить MX-запись (Mail Exchanger Record) для указания сервера, обрабатывающего почту для доменного имени. MX-запись нужна только, если будет работать почтовый сервер.
    6. При необходимости добавить другие записи DNS в зависимости от сервера и требований проекта.

    Создание зон и записей DNS может быть сложным. Лучше обратиться к специалистам или изучить литературу до создания собственного сервера без хостинга.

    Оцените статью